The Journey to Your Aircraft Hangar


Planning and Design Phase

The journey begins with the planning and design phase, which includes initial consultations, drafting of plans, and obtaining the necessary permits. This phase can vary in length but typically takes several months. For a hangar size ranging from 3,500 to 10,000 square feet, one might expect the design phase to last anywhere from 1 to 3 months.


Construction Phase

Following the design phase, we move into construction. The construction phase can take anywhere from 9 to 18 months, depending on the complexity of the hangar design, materials used, and other factors such as contractor availability and weather conditions.


Certificate of Occupancy

Once construction is complete, the hangar must pass final inspections to ensure it meets all building codes and safety standards. After these inspections are passed, a certificate of occupancy is issued, which can take a few weeks to a month[4].


Unit Cost of the Hangar

The cost per square foot for building an aircraft hangar can vary widely. Industry sources suggest that the cost can range from $50 to $120 per square foot for a basic hangar, not including specialized systems or luxury finishes. For a more customized or high-end hangar, costs can be significantly higher.


Total Timeframe and Cost Summary

Combining all phases, the total time from design to certificate of occupancy for a private aircraft hangar in Southern Texas could range from approximately 12 to 24 months. For a hangar size of 3,500 to 10,000 square feet, the total construction cost (excluding land acquisition) would range from $175,000 to $1,200,000 based on the aforementioned cost-per-square-foot estimates.
